Adomah pens Boro extension

Middlesbrough have handed winger Albert Adomah a contract extension.
The 26-year-old, who signed for Boro at the start of last season for a £1million fee, will now stay at the Riverside until the end of the 2016/17 season.
Adomah has been an integral part of Aitor Karanka's side and has scored three goals in 18 appearances this term as Boro mount a promotion challenge in the Sky Bet Championship.
Adomah's extension comes hot on the heels of a new deal for midfielder Adam Reach, with Grant Leadbitter set to be next at the negotiation table, with Karanka determined to keep his star assets in the north east.
